Fun Fact: It costs over 3000$ today The design dates from the 1860s, and is attributed to Louis Dolne. The gun was manufactured until the end of the 1800s. One of the rarest gambler/hide away/ personal defense deringers around. Incorporates a 6mm (22) rimfire revolver, “knuckles” that unfold to provide a grip for the revolver and a 2 1/2” folding dagger. Weapon is 4” long when folded. Expands to 8” when at full length. Marked “Dolne - 6mm” (L. Dolne - Imuur) on frame, folding trigger and exposed springs. Brushed finish, overall excellent. Known as the Apache Knuckle-duster (Up-Pash) for the Parisian fighters, called Apaches, that colonized the French capital starting in 1875.
